loader image

Best Practices for Mobile App Development to Ensure Success

Table of Contents

Introduction

Building a high-quality mobile app requires more than just development skills. It involves strategic planning, exceptional design, continuous optimization, and user engagement strategies.

📌 In this article, we’ll cover best practices that will help ensure your mobile app is successful, engaging, and optimized for long-term growth.

Why Does Mobile App Quality Matter?

A well-developed mobile app can:

  • Increase user engagement and retention.
  • Boost business revenue through in-app purchases or ads.
  • Improve customer satisfaction by providing a smooth experience.
  • Enhance your brand’s credibility and visibility.
Best Practices for Developing High-Quality Mobile Apps
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Understanding Your Target Audience
  • Conduct thorough market research to understand user needs and preferences.
  • Identify pain points and develop solutions tailored to your audience.
  • Analyze competitors and look for areas of improvement in their apps.
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Creating an Exceptional User Experience (UX/UI)
  • Design a simple, intuitive, and visually appealing interface.
  • Ensure smooth navigation with easy-to-access menus and buttons.
  • Use color psychology and typography to enhance readability.
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Optimizing App Performance
  • Reduce app loading time by optimizing backend processes.
  • Compress images and media files to enhance performance.
  • Ensure efficient memory usage to avoid crashes or slowdowns.
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Ensuring Data Security and Privacy
  • Implement end-to-end encryption for sensitive data.
  • Use two-factor authentication (2FA) for added security.
  • Ensure compliance with GDPR, CCPA, and other privacy regulations.
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Enhancing App Store Optimization (ASO)
  • Use relevant keywords and compelling descriptions for better search visibility.
  • Optimize app icons, screenshots, and preview videos for higher engagement.
  • Encourage positive reviews and ratings to improve credibility.
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Conducting Rigorous Testing Before Launch
  • Perform beta testing with real users to gather feedback.
  • Test across different devices and OS versions to ensure compatibility.
  • Identify and fix bugs before the official launch.
  • Discover 5 best practices for mobile app development to ensure success, improve user experience, boost performance, and achieve long-term app growth.
    Continuous Updates and Performance Monitoring
  • Gather user feedback and implement improvements regularly.
  • Use analytics tools to track user behavior and app performance.
  • Roll out updates with new features and security patches.
Top Tools and Technologies for Mobile App Development
  • Programming Languages:
  • Swift & Objective-C (iOS)
  • Kotlin & Java (Android)
  • Flutter & React Native (Cross-Platform)
  • Development Frameworks & IDEs:
  • Xcode (for iOS Development)
  • Android Studio (for Android Development)
  • Firebase (for Backend & Analytics)
  • Testing & Debugging Tools:
  • Appium, Selenium (for automated testing)
  • TestFlight (for iOS beta testing)
  • Firebase Analytics
How to Guarantee the Success of Your Mobile App?

Follow these steps to maximize app success:

  • Engage users through push notifications and in-app offers.
  • Implement personalization features for a tailored experience.
  • Continuously improve the app based on user feedback and analytics.
  • Invest in marketing and App Store Optimization (ASO).
How Esnad Tech Delivers High-Quality Mobile Apps

At Esnad Tech  we specialize in building top-tier mobile apps with a focus on performance, security, and user experience.

Why Choose Esnad Tech?

  • Expert team with years of experience in mobile app development.
  • User-centric approach to ensure the best UX/UI.
  • Cutting-edge technologies for high performance and scalability.
  • Ongoing maintenance and updates to keep your app competitive.

📌 Looking for a reliable mobile app development partner? Esnad Tech is the answer! 🚀

Conclusion

Developing a successful mobile app requires attention to detail, best practices, and a user-first approach. By focusing on UX, security, performance, and continuous improvement, your app can stand out in the market.

📲 Want to build a high-quality mobile app?

Table of Contents

Our Services
Software Development.

Mobile App Development.

Website Development.

E-commerce Development.

Motion Graphic Services.

Graphic Design Services.

Digital Marketing Services.

Cybersecurity Services.

Supply and installation.

خدمات الأمن السيبراني

Related Posts

Build your e-commerce store in 7 proven steps that boost sales, enhance user experience, and ensure long-term success through effective strategy and smart tools.

Discover 7 powerful strategies for e-commerce store development to boost performance, enhance user experience, and grow online business with best practices.

Discover 5 powerful ways to develop business applications that boost productivity, enhance efficiency, streamline operations, and drive business growth.

Contact Us

Leave a Reply

Your email address will not be published. Required fields are marked *